Corrugated roof installation services involve fitting durable, corrugated metal panels onto a property's existing roof structure. This process typically includes preparing the roof surface, measuring and cutting panels to fit, and securely fastening them to ensure a weather-tight seal. The goal is to create a sturdy, long-lasting roofing system that can withstand various weather conditions and provide reliable protection for the building below. Homeowners interested in this service often seek a practical, cost-effective roofing solution that offers both durability and ease of maintenance.
These services are especially valuable for addressing common roofing problems such as leaks, rust, or damage caused by severe weather. Corrugated metal roofs are resistant to moisture, pests, and corrosion, making them an effective choice for preventing future issues. Installing a new corrugated roof can also improve energy efficiency by reflecting sunlight and reducing heat transfer. The overview below groups typical Corrugated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Saline,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or corrugated roof repairs in Saline, MI range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as patching leaks or replacing small sections, fall within this range. Larger or more complex repairs can cost more depending on the extent of the damage.
Partial Installation - Installing a new corrugated roof on a small to medium-sized section often costs between $1,000 and $3,500. Most projects in this category are completed within this range, though larger or more intricate jobs may exceed it.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ire corrugated roof typically ranges from $4,000 to $8,000 for average-sized projects around Saline, MI. Many full replacements fall into this middle range, with larger or custom jobs reaching higher costs.
Large or Commercial Projects - Larger, more complex corrugated roofing projects for commercial or extensive residential properties can cost $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and tend to be at the higher end of the cost spectrum due to scope and materials invol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a corrugated roof? Corrugated roofing offers durability, weather resistance, and a lightweight design that can enhance the longevity of a building.
What types of buildings are suitable for corrugated roof installation? Corrugated roofs are commonly installed on sheds, barns, industrial structures, and residential extensions where a sturdy, cost-effective roofing solution is needed.
How do local contractors ensure proper installation of corrugated roofing? Experienced service providers follow manufacturer guidelines and best practices to ensure the roofing is securely installed and properly sealed against the elements.
What materials are typically used for corrugated roofing? Corrugated roofing is usually made from metal, fiberglass, or plastic, each offering different levels of durability and aesthetic options.
What maintenance is required after a corrugated roof is installed? Regular inspections for damage, cleaning to remove debris, and prompt repairs of any leaks or rust help maintain the roof’s performance over time.
